Output 6297ee9463d79375ababb12329dfa3b25dad83655af3ddd51823c21c92fab62d:0

value
416212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81c83f22bb2177d828b167d6917100b0c3e77f2 OP_EQUAL
address
3MPi3GK7duczQAsb78i2pnY9dHyoP23AfD
transaction
6297ee9463d79375ababb12329dfa3b25dad83655af3ddd51823c21c92fab62d
confirmations
221870
spent
true